The token economy system is a popular method used in behavioral therapy to help individuals develop and maintain positive behaviors. This article will provide examples of how the token economy system can be applied in high schools to promote positive behavior, reduce problematic behaviors, and improve the overall school climate.

1. Graduation Rewards

One of the most common applications of the token economy system in high schools is graduation rewards. Students who demonstrate appropriate behavior and academic success can earn tokens, which they can then trade for rewards such as extra recess, time out of class, or special events. This incentive-based approach encourages students to engage in positive behaviors and encourages them to work hard in their academics.

2. Conduct Incentives

Another example of the token economy system in high schools is the conduct incentive program. In this program, students who maintain appropriate behavior can earn tokens, which they can then trade for rewards such as extra credit, special privileges, or gift cards. This approach helps to create a positive school climate by encouraging students to adhere to the school's code of conduct.

3. Positive Behavior Supports

The token economy system can also be used to support positive behaviors in high schools. For example, teachers can use tokens to recognize students who demonstrate outstanding efforts in their learning or who exhibit positive behaviors such as cooperation and respect. By providing positive feedback in this manner, teachers can help students develop a growth mindset and encourage them to continue engaging in positive behaviors.

4. Behavioral Interventions

In some cases, the token economy system may be used as a behavioral intervention to address problematic behaviors in high school students. For example, if a student is engaging in excessive bullying or harassment, the school can implement a token economy program to provide positive incentives for the student to change their behavior. By creating a clear structure and expectations for behavior, the token economy system can help students understand the consequences of their actions and encourage them to adopt more positive behaviors.

5. Community Service

Finally, the token economy system can be used to encourage students to participate in community service activities. Students can earn tokens for completing service projects, and these tokens can then be traded for rewards such as extra credit or special events. By incorporating community service into the token economy system, high schools can help students develop a sense of responsibility and empathy for their community.
